Reading the Omnibus figured I'd review a good portion of it that's collected it epic eollection volume 1.

So the first half is mostly one shots of Moon Knight's first appearances. Coming in almost as a villain but redeeming himself by the end when hunting the werewolf guy. Then he dips into the Defenders a bit and that's okay. He even teams up with Spidy, because Spidy sells, so hooray all around!

But then we get into solo Moon Knight and MAN is it good and surprisingly dark. So Moon Knight does a few missions, being that he switches between his different secret identities (This is before he gets the whole split personality thing) and by the end of the storyline we get one about Marc's brother and his revenge on him. He's basically a serial killer going around murdering people with a hatchet till he finds his brother.

It's thrilling and brutal, way more than I expected, and by the end I was worried about multiple characters. Then we actually have Marc deal with the fallout, which is also great and worked maturely.

Then we finally get to the first 4 issues of the main Moon Knight run. First issue being his origin, which I already knew pretty well. But then we get one shots, but they're all dark and some right down sad. We also set up Marc's team of help, a diner waitress, a bum, and two teenagers plus his helicopter pilot, his sexy girlfriend Marlene, and his butler. This is a crazy ass team yet works well in context.

So to say I really enjoyed this by the end would be underselling it. I liked the second half so much I bought volume 2 of the Omnibus the next day. Can't wait to read more. This is a very solid 4 out of 5.
